== Build Provenance: Template Rendering Perf ==

The Cindermoor rendering benchmarks discussed at this week's sync were produced from a pinned toolchain, not the floating nightly. All timing deltas (the 18% improvement in partial caching) are attributable to commit-level changes, not compiler drift. Anyone reproducing the numbers should verify their environment against the same artifact. The provenance token for that build appears below.

build token for tawip-yageg: htk9_92ac43d42

Welcome to the Keyspinner runbook

Keyspinner is our homegrown secrets-rotation utility — it cycles database creds, API tokens, and signing keys across the Fernwhistle fleet every 30 days. Mostly it just hums along via cron. Where you'll actually need this doc: if a rotation fails midway, Keyspinner locks its own state store to avoid half-rotated secrets. Don't panic, that's by design. Run `keyspinner resume` and, when prompted to unlock the state store, enter the recovery passphrase shown below.

strongbox words: prawyn-fenmir

Welcome to on-call for the Glimmerpane design system! Our snapshot tests live in the `snapcheck` suite and run on every merge to main. If a UI component changes visually, the diff bot flags it — usually it's an intentional tweak, so just approve the new baseline. If it's 2am and snapshots are failing across the board, it's almost always a font-loading race, not your problem. To unlock the baseline store and re-approve snapshots in bulk, use the recovery passphrase below.

recovery phrase for tahag-taguf: wenix-caswyn

Step 4: Enable the Quillbrook queue-depth autoscaler

Once the worker fleet is on release 7.2, switch scaling from CPU-based to queue-depth-based. Drain one worker pool at a time and confirm the backlog metric is publishing before enabling the new policy. Rollback simply means reverting the policy flag. Apply the following configuration values to the autoscaler before cutover.

settings of fafog-haduf:
ZORIX_PIN=4648
ZORIX_METRICS_HOST=metrics.zorix.paliqsys.corp
ZORIX_LOG_LEVEL=info
ZORIX_TENANT=druix